Binding agent screening and grinding integrated machine
Technical Field
The utility model relates to a superhard materials processing production technical field, concretely relates to binder sieve grinds all-in-one.
Background
With the development of science and technology, modern grinding processing is developed towards high speed, high efficiency and high precision. Especially, the combined saw blade for woodworking circular saw blade and CNC and part of special-shaped PCD cutters require high precision of the processed surface and good finish, and the shapes of a plurality of grinding wheels require special shapes, so most of the selected grinding wheels are superhard grinding wheels.
At present, the material when superhard grinding wheel makes includes abrasive material and binder, the binder need be in proper order through the melting calcination, the cooling is smashed, grinding screening just can be used to the preparation to superhard grinding wheel, but in prior art, because binder grinding device's inner structure is complicated, make grinding device have the purchasing cost height, the inconvenient problem of maintaining the detection, binder grinding device among the current simultaneously, because all grind the back direct discharge with the raw materials, and the discharge gate does not have the function of screening, so that also can discharge thereupon when excreting not fully ground material, lead to sieving once more, and cause the problem that production efficiency is low.

Example one
Referring to fig. 1-6, the binder screening and grinding integrated machine comprises a grinding and screening device, wherein the grinding and screening device comprises a screen cylinder 11, a steel ball 12, a cover body 13 and a support 14.
The screen drum 11 is horizontally installed on the top of the support 14, the screen drum 11 includes an arc-shaped connecting plate 111, a first connecting piece 112 and a second connecting piece 113, the arc-shaped connecting plate 111 includes an arc-shaped long plate portion 111a and a frame connecting portion 111b, and the frame connecting portion 111b is fixed on the outer wall of the arc-shaped long plate portion 111 a.
The number of the arc-shaped connecting plates 111 is eight, the eight arc-shaped connecting plates 111 are assembled and fixed into a barrel structure through frame connecting parts 111b of the arc-shaped connecting plates 111, the number of the eight arc-shaped connecting plates 111 is eight, two arc-shaped connecting plates 111 in the arc-shaped connecting plates 111 are provided with leak holes 2, and the two arc-shaped connecting plates 111 with the leak holes 2 are arranged at opposite positions.
The first connecting piece 112 is fixed at one end of the cylinder body formed by the arc-shaped connecting plate 111 in a sealing manner, the second connecting piece 113 is fixed at the other end of the cylinder body formed by the arc-shaped connecting plate 111 in a sealing manner, and the second connecting piece 113 is provided with a feeding hole 113 a.
The outer wall of the second connecting piece 113 and the outer wall of the first connecting piece 112 are rotatably connected to the support 14, the drive device 3 is mounted on the support 14, and the drive device 3 is in transmission connection with the first connecting piece 112.
The number of the steel balls 12 is multiple, and the multiple steel balls 12 are all arranged in the screen drum 11.
The cover body 13 is installed on the top of the support 14, the screen drum 11 is located in the cover body 13, and the bottom of the cover body 13 is provided with a discharge hole 131.
The support 14 is provided with a collecting box 15, and the collecting box 15 is arranged under the cover body 13.
One side of the collecting box 15 is provided with an observation window, and the other side is provided with a handle.
In this embodiment, when the device uses, the binder raw materials pass through feed inlet 113a and get into sieve section of thick bamboo 11, with the help of drive arrangement 3 down, sieve section of thick bamboo 11 rotates, drive steel ball 12 in the barrel, the binder raw materials rotates, when steel ball 12 rotates and reaches a take the altitude, under steel ball 12 self gravity is greater than centrifugal force, steel ball 12 breaks away from the barrel inner wall and casts whereabouts or rolls down, realize breaking up the raw materials, simultaneously under the frictional force of a plurality of steel ball 12 mutual slip productions, realize the abundant grinding to the material, make the abundant material of grinding discharge through small opening 2, and the bold material continues to grind in sieve section of thick bamboo 11.
Preferably, the arc-shaped connecting plate 111 further includes a convex edge portion 111c, the convex edge portion 111c is a semicircular structure, the convex edge portion 111c is fixed on two sides of the arc-shaped long plate portion 111a, the convex edge portion 111c is disposed on the inner wall of the arc-shaped connecting plate 111 along the length direction thereof, and the convex edge portion 111c is used for better driving the steel ball to rotate, so that the binder raw material is sufficiently crushed and ground.
Preferably, the outer wall of the arc-shaped connecting plate 111 is fixed with a long supporting block 114, the long supporting block 114 is fixedly arranged along the length direction of the arc-shaped long plate part 111a, and the long supporting block 114 effectively prolongs the service life of the arc-shaped connecting plate 114.
